Hello
I am trying to launch a psecond window (it's of type "Top Level").
Once I launch it, by calling Window2.show() it appears, but it sits on
top of the main Window. And there's nothing I can do, short of
dragging the new window off the screen. On another mailing list they
mentioned how, in Glade, I should set the "Visible" option to "no",
but if I do this, then it makes the problem worse as the window does
not even open.
To make matters worse, this Window2, when being hovered over, launches
another window. Now I want this Window3 to sit on top, but now it
stubbornly sits underneath the Window2.
